How to fill out standing order form

How to fill out a standing order form?
01
Obtain the standing order form: The first step is to obtain the standing order form from the relevant financial institution. This form can usually be downloaded from their website or collected from a branch.
02
Fill in personal details: The form will typically require you to provide your personal details such as your name, address, and contact information. Ensure that these details are accurately and legibly filled in.
03
Provide your bank account information: Next, you will need to enter your bank account details. This includes your account number, bank name, and branch address. Double-check these details to avoid any errors.
04
Specify the recipient details: Indicate the recipient's details, which may include their name, address, and account number. It's important to correctly provide this information to ensure that the funds are directed to the intended recipient.
05
Set the payment frequency and amount: Decide on the frequency of the payments you wish to make through the standing order, such as weekly, monthly, or annually. Additionally, specify the amount you want to transfer with each payment. Make sure to write the amount clearly and precisely.
06
Provide any necessary reference or code: If there is a specific reference or code required for the standing order, ensure that you include it in the designated section of the form. This is particularly important for payments that require a reference number, such as bill payments or subscriptions.
07
Sign and date the form: Once you have completed all the relevant sections of the standing order form, sign and date it. This indicates your consent and authorization for the financial institution to set up the standing order according to the provided instructions.
Who needs a standing order form?
01
Individuals with regular financial commitments: A standing order form is useful for individuals who need to make regular payments for bills, rent, mortgage, or loan repayments. By setting up a standing order, you can ensure that these payments are made on time without having to remember or manually initiate the transfers each time.
02
Employers and employees: Standing orders are commonly used by employers to facilitate the regular payment of salaries or wages to their employees. This eliminates the need for manual payments or issuing checks, providing a convenient and efficient payment method.
03
Organizations and charities: Non-profit organizations, charities, and clubs often rely on standing orders for receiving regular donations or membership fees. It simplifies the collection process and ensures a consistent flow of funds to support their activities.
Overall, standing order forms are beneficial for anyone who wants to establish a regular transfer of funds for a specific purpose or recurring payments. It helps automate financial transactions, saving time and effort for both the sender and the recipient.

What is standing order form?
A standing order form is a document that authorizes a bank to regularly pay a fixed amount of money from one account to another.
Who is required to file standing order form?
Any individual or business that wants to set up a regular payment from their bank account is required to file a standing order form.
How to fill out standing order form?
To fill out a standing order form, you will need to provide details such as the recipient's account number, sort code, the amount to be paid, and the frequency of the payments.
What is the purpose of standing order form?
The purpose of a standing order form is to automate regular payments, such as rent, utility bills, or subscriptions, without the need for manual intervention each time.
What information must be reported on standing order form?
The standing order form must include the recipient's account details, the amount to be paid, the frequency of the payments, and the sender's account details.
